About

The Exploration Tower at Port Canaveral offers seven floors of hands-on discovery perfect for curious kids who love ships, space, and ocean life. This interactive learning center combines stunning 360-degree views from the observation deck with engaging exhibits about the Space Coast's maritime history, wildlife, and connection to space exploration,all in a family-friendly environment that makes education feel like an adventure.

Highlights

  • Seventh-floor observation deck with panoramic views of cruise ships, the Atlantic Ocean, and sometimes rocket launches
  • Interactive exhibits about Port Canaveral's history and the region's connection to space exploration
  • Simulated ship bridge where kids can pretend to captain a vessel
  • Educational displays about local marine life and ecosystems
  • Opportunity to watch cruise ships and cargo vessels coming and going from the port

Pro Tips

  1. 1.Start at the top floor observation deck first to get oriented and spot cruise ships, then work your way down through the exhibits when kids are most energetic
  2. 2.Visit on cruise ship departure days (typically afternoons) for exciting views of massive ships leaving port
  3. 3.Bring binoculars for the observation deck to spot wildlife, rockets at Kennedy Space Center in the distance, and ships on the horizon
  4. 4.The tower is less crowded on weekday mornings, giving kids more space to interact with exhibits
  5. 5.Combine your visit with a walk along the nearby Port Canaveral waterfront and Jetty Park Beach for a full day out

Best Time to Visit

Weekday mornings between 10am-12pm offer smaller crowds and comfortable temperatures. Visit in fall or spring for pleasant weather on the open-air observation deck, avoiding summer's intense midday heat.

What to Know

Admission is budget-friendly at around $6.50 for adults and $4.50 for kids. Free parking is available on-site, and the tower has elevators making it stroller and wheelchair accessible throughout all seven floors.

Seasonal Notes

Open year-round, but the outdoor observation deck can be hot and exposed during summer months (June-August). Winter offers the most comfortable viewing conditions. Check ahead for potential closures during severe weather or hurricanes.
